Case-Shiller Reports Fastest Home Price Growth in Two Years
Home prices rose at their fastest rate in two years according to Case-Shiller Home Price Indices. The National Home Price Index for August showed 5.70 percent home price growth year-over-year as compared to 4.80 percent growth reported in July. The … [Continue reading]
